cats question


I recently had that cats taken off my 2000 mustang. 4 days later the check engine light came on. Is there a sensor or sumthing after the cats that may be reading wrong? if so what can be done bout this?

yes, there are O2 sensors that make sure the cats are working. you need either mil eliminators or you need a tuner to turn ther rear O2 sensor off
